Output 76b0e6971490e4cd4bda1712001c601fd84f0373b9fa8091d15bc371e562b27a:6

value
513254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f00f0cba863a97c0f14f5c332b94a5b7c075a5 OP_EQUAL
address
34L2RVVN3QCDiv8ym2L8QsVs2XqVk5wjbk
transaction
76b0e6971490e4cd4bda1712001c601fd84f0373b9fa8091d15bc371e562b27a
spent
true